Hi Jim,

So is there a range of incoming single CC values that you want to convert to a set of outgoing multiple CC values? If so, could you be more specific on the input CC and values you want coming in and what the resulting output values would be.

As to a general answer, you can in fact do this with rules. You would use the rules to evaluate the incoming CC and value and then send out different output CC and values using raw MIDI messages adjusting the CC and the value depending on the range.

OK, so assuming you want all 5 drawbars to move in unison, as with most things, there are a couple of ways to approach this.

Method 1 – A single translator to send out 5 separate MIDI message via raw MIDI

Method 2 – 5 separate translators with the same input trigger each sending out a different CC message.

Method 1 would look like this:

——
Translator : Send 5 CC
Incoming: Control Change Channel 1 Controller 53 Any value set value to qq
——-
Rules:

// None

// End of Rules
——-
Outgoing: Raw MIDI B0 18 qq B0 19 qq B0 1A qq B0 1B qq B0 1C qq
Options: Swallow
——

Note that in the above, we convert the decimal values of 24-28 to hex 18-1C

 

Method 2
——
Translator : Send 24
Incoming: Control Change Channel 1 Controller 53 Any value set value to qq
——-
Rules:
// None

// End of Rules
——-
Outgoing: Control Change Channel 1 Controller 24 value qq
Options: Swallow
——
Then duplicate the above translator 4 more times changing the output controller(and translator name) for each for the remaining controls you want to send.

I normally set this up and test it with MT Pro and then transfer the project to BomeBox after tested.

Of course you need to set up your proper default input and output MIDI ports as well.
